Why Your Water Pipes Are Noisy and How To Shut Them Up
To diagnose noisy plumbing, it is necessary to determine initial whether the unwanted noises take place on the system's inlet side-in other words, when water is turned on-or on the drainpipe side. Noises on the inlet side have actually differed causes: too much water pressure, worn shutoff and tap components, improperly attached pumps or other home appliances, inaccurately placed pipeline bolts, and plumbing runs consisting of too many tight bends or various other constraints. Noises on the drainpipe side generally stem from bad area or, as with some inlet side noise, a format having tight bends.

Hissing


Hissing noise that takes place when a tap is opened slightly normally signals too much water pressure. Consult your local public utility if you believe this problem; it will have the ability to tell you the water stress in your location and also can install a pressurereducing valve on the incoming water system pipeline if necessary.

Other Inlet Side Noises


Creaking, squealing, damaging, breaking, and also touching usually are caused by the growth or contraction of pipelines, normally copper ones providing warm water. The sounds occur as the pipes slide against loose fasteners or strike close-by home framework. You can often pinpoint the location of the issue if the pipes are subjected; just comply with the noise when the pipelines are making sounds. More than likely you will certainly uncover a loosened pipeline wall mount or a location where pipelines exist so near flooring joists or various other mounting items that they clatter versus them. Connecting foam pipeline insulation around the pipelines at the point of get in touch with need to correct the trouble. Make sure bands as well as hangers are protected as well as offer sufficient support. Where possible, pipe bolts need to be affixed to substantial architectural components such as structure walls instead of to framing; doing so lessens the transmission of resonances from plumbing to surface areas that can intensify as well as transfer them. If connecting fasteners to framework is inescapable, cover pipes with insulation or other resilient product where they speak to fasteners, and also sandwich completions of new bolts in between rubber washers when mounting them.
Fixing plumbing runs that suffer from flow-restricting limited or various bends is a last resort that must be carried out just after seeking advice from an experienced plumbing specialist. Unfortunately, this circumstance is fairly usual in older houses that might not have been constructed with interior plumbing or that have seen several remodels, particularly by beginners.

Babbling or Screeching


Extreme chattering or shrieking that occurs when a shutoff or faucet is activated, which typically vanishes when the installation is opened completely, signals loose or faulty inner parts. The option is to replace the valve or tap with a brand-new one.
Pumps as well as appliances such as cleaning devices and dish washers can transfer electric motor noise to pipelines if they are incorrectly attached. Connect such items to plumbing with plastic or rubber hoses-never inflexible pipe-to isolate them.

Drainpipe Noise


On the drainpipe side of plumbing, the chief objectives are to get rid of surfaces that can be struck by dropping or rushing water and also to insulate pipelines to contain inescapable sounds.
In brand-new construction, tubs, shower stalls, commodes, and wallmounted sinks and also basins must be set on or versus resilient underlayments to lower the transmission of sound with them. Water-saving commodes and taps are much less noisy than traditional versions; install them rather than older kinds even if codes in your location still allow using older components.
Drains that do not run up and down to the basement or that branch into straight pipe runs supported at flooring joists or various other framing present specifically troublesome noise issues. Such pipelines are large enough to emit substantial vibration; they likewise bring substantial amounts of water, which makes the scenario even worse. In new construction, specify cast-iron soil pipelines (the huge pipelines that drain pipes commodes) if you can manage them. Their enormity has a lot of the noise made by water going through them. Likewise, stay clear of transmitting drains in walls shared with bed rooms as well as areas where individuals collect. Walls containing drainpipes ought to be soundproofed as was explained previously, making use of dual panels of sound-insulating fiber board and also wallboard. Pipelines themselves can be wrapped with unique fiberglass insulation created the objective; such pipelines have a resistant plastic skin (sometimes having lead). Outcomes are not constantly acceptable.

Thudding


Thudding noise, frequently accompanied by shuddering pipes, when a faucet or appliance valve is turned off is a condition called water hammer. The noise and vibration are brought on by the resounding wave of stress in the water, which instantly has no area to go. Occasionally opening up a shutoff that releases water swiftly into a section of piping including a restriction, joint, or tee installation can generate the exact same problem.
Water hammer can typically be cured by installing fittings called air chambers or shock absorbers in the plumbing to which the trouble shutoffs or taps are linked. These devices allow the shock wave developed by the halted circulation of water to dissipate in the air they include, which (unlike water) is compressible.
Older plumbing systems may have brief upright areas of capped pipe behind walls on tap competes the exact same purpose; these can at some point loaded with water, minimizing or ruining their effectiveness. The treatment is to drain pipes the water system completely by shutting down the primary supply of water valve and also opening all faucets. After that open up the main supply shutoff as well as close the taps one by one, starting with the tap nearest the shutoff and finishing with the one farthest away.

WHY IS MY PLUMBING MAKING SO MUCH NOISE?


This noise indeed sounds like someone is banging a hammer against your pipes! It happens when a faucet is opened, allowed to run for a bit, then quickly shut — causing the rushing water to slam against the shut-off valve.



To remedy this, you’ll need to check and refill your air chamber. Air chambers are filled with — you guessed it — air and help absorb the shock of moving water (that comes to a sudden stop). Over time, these chambers can fill with water, making them less effective.



You’ll want to turn off your home’s water supply, then open ALL faucets (from the bathroom sink to outdoor hose bib) to drain your pipes. Then, turn the water back on and hopefully the noise stops! If you’re still hearing the sound, give us a call to examine further.


Whistles


Whistling sounds can be frustrating, as sometimes the source isn’t easily identified. However, if you can pinpoint which faucet or valve that may be the cause, you’ll likely encounter a worn gasket or washer — an easy fix if you replace the worn parts!Whistling sounds from elsewhere can mean a number of things — from high water pressure to mineral deposits. Cracks or Ticks


Cracking or ticking typically comes from hot water going through cold, copper pipes. This causes the copper to expand resulting in a cracking or ticking sound. Once the pipes stop expanding, the noise should stop as well.



Pro tip: you may want to lower the temperature of your water heater to see if that helps lessen the sound, or wrapping the pipe in insulation can also help muffle the noise.


Bangs


Bangs typically come from water pressure that’s too high. To test for high water pressure, get a pressure gauge and attach it to your faucet. Water pressure should be no higher than 80 psi (pounds per square inch) and also no lower than 40 psi. If you find a number greater than 80 psi, then you’ve found your problem!
